Indian Diet During Pregnancy
Pregnant ladies should have a balanced
diet during pregnancy. This article provides an insight into what kind
of Indian diet should be taken during pregnancy.
Pregnant mothers always wonder that
what they should eat & what not. Some says a mother should take the
diet of two people because she needs to take care of one more life. But
is it true, if yes what they should eat & if not how the baby will
get proper diet to grow as a healthy child. When you will consult with a
doctor they will say a pregnant mother must take a balanced diet. So
that mother & child both gets a proper nutrition for their body.
Basically Balanced diet must contain some or other thing from the entire
food group. Not only this but balanced diet also meant to keep track on
the proper quantity, quality & reaction or allergy of any food on
mother. Following tips will help you and your baby stay healthy.
- As it has been strictly prescribed by doctors that intake of
Vitamin A must be controlled because it may cause damage to embryo.
- Cabbage, Cauli-flower & all long green vegetables such as
Tondali, Turai, Louki, Parwal, Spinach, Govari should be used
alternately. You must keep balance, rather than eating same
vegetable all the time.
- Reduce brinjal, suran/yam, papaya, celery, onion, chilli, garlic,
ginger, pepper, asfoetida, mustard, bajara, carom seeds, jaggery
from your diet. You must remember that those who have previous
history of abortion better they must avoid these.
- Those who suffer from constipation, gas, bloating must avoid peas
and other `heavy to digest' cereals, potato. They must take green
gram as it is easy to digest and gives protein.
- Black grapes, banana, ripe mango, dates, cashewnuts, apricot are
very beneficial.
- Butter, clarified butter, milk, honey, fennel seeds, sweets made
from jaggery rather than white sugar can be taken in small quantity.
- Rice, Murmure, pulao, Bhakari, Khichri, Chapati, Paratha,
Gujarati thepla are the items made from wheat and rice, so they are
quite beneficial.
- Items such as sandwich, bakery bread, bun, dhokla, pizza, handva,
pancake, khaman, steamed rice cake, curd, tomato, tamarind, kadhi
usually increase the swellings and acidity. So, try to avoid such
item but if such problems do not exist, you can take in small
quantity.
- Indian women try to carry out fasts during pregnancy which is not
good for health.
- Do not eat left over, frozen & deep-frozen food.
- Avoid cold drinks, mutton, cocoa, chicken, eggs, alcohol,
smoking, tobacco, betel nut, pan-masala but tea, coffee &
ice-creams can be taken in small quantity.
- Remember, the baby inside depends on you for proper nutrition.
So, if you will take healthy & balanced diet your child will
become healthy.
- During pregnancy, mother must focus on supplemental nutrients
while maintaining a balanced and nutritious diet. They must get a
list of healthy Indian foods and meal planning tips from doctor to
eat well during a pregnancy.
Indian women must maintain a high quality diet during their pregnancy
to get a healthy, fit & fine baby. Now start following your diet
chart to become a healthy mom.
